#578f3c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#578f3c is composed of 34.1% red, 56.1% green and 23.5%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 39.2% cyan, 0% magenta, 58% yellow and 43.9% black. It has a hue angle of 100.5 degrees, a saturation of 40.9% and a lightness of 39.8%. #578f3c color hex could be obtained by blending #aeff78 with #001f00. Closest websafe color is: #669933.

Shades and Tints of #578f3c
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#030502 is the darkest color, while #f8fbf6 is the lightest one.
